Description
IN SUMMARY
Having undergone a recent FULL RENOVATION including a full re-wire and new central heating system, this SEMI-DETACHED HOME offers VERSATILITY in space across two floors all immaculately presented. The ground floor offers both a 16’ DUAL ASPECT SITTING ROOM as well as a separate DINING ROOM all set upon SOLID OAK FLOORING which flows through the ground floor to the rear where a CONSIDERABLE EXTENSION has been added to create a STUNNING KITCHEN with INTEGRATED APPLIANCES, large SKYLIGHT fitted above the kitchen island, UTILITY ROOM and ground floor WC. The first floor landing gives way to THREE BEDROOMS all served by a fully MODERNISED FOUR PIECE BATHROOM suite complete with UNDERFLOOR HEATING. The rear garden is FULLY ENCLOSED and offers privacy in every corner with a 18’x10’ bespoke built timber shed which has been FULLY INSULATED with it’s own ELECTRIC supply making this an incredibly versatile space, handy for almost any potential use.

Anti-Money Laundering (AML) Fee Statement:
To comply with HMRC's regulations on Anti-Money Laundering (AML), we are legally required to conduct AML checks on every purchaser once a sale is agreed. We use a government-approved electronic identity verification service to ensure compliance, accuracy, and security. This is approved by the Government as part of the Digital Identity and Attributes Trust Framework (DIATF). The cost of anti-money laundering (AML) checks are £50 including VAT per person, payable in advance after an offer has been accepted. This fee is mandatory to comply with HMRC regulations and must be paid before a memorandum of sale can be issued. Please note that the fee is non-refundable.
